Interactions between doctors and pharmaceutical sales representatives
By Joel Lexchin MD CCFPEM DABEM

The article by Strang and colleagues (pages 73-77) in the present issue of the Journal
tells us what information doctors want from pharmaceutical sales representatives of
pharmaceutical companies. Specifically, besides information about indications and
benefits, physicians want detailed safety data, comparative data between new and old
drugs, and the prices of products.
